This made the Saanenland a welcome choice for sporty yet budget-conscious families. Now, children up to nine years old must purchase a lift ticket at 31 francs; those up to age 20 will need to spend 47 francs for a day pass.

Complicating matters somewhat is the fact that most other bordering regions still maintain the under nine ski free policy, meaning the Saanenland slopes are an island of higher prices in a sea of less costly options. Softening the blow somewhat is the new, lower price of just 62 francs for an adult lift ticket for the day.
